Output ae590234c4335cbd31a3d26f6817b4f9c27acc1928f5d1ac2b83d26b9e3f13ee:31

value
7092800
script pubkey
OP_0 OP_PUSHBYTES_20 3dd56d8117c4a7658def6db81e07f25ec676ebb3
address
ltc1q8h2kmqghcjnktr00dkupupljtmr8d6anznu2f4
transaction
ae590234c4335cbd31a3d26f6817b4f9c27acc1928f5d1ac2b83d26b9e3f13ee
spent
true